Understanding Demolition/Clearance in Huddersfield

Huddersfield, a vibrant town in West Yorkshire, is known for its rich history and architectural beauty. However, like any other town, it sometimes requires the removal of old structures to make way for new developments. This is where demolition and clearance services come into play. These services are crucial for urban development, ensuring safety, and maintaining the town's aesthetic appeal.

The Importance of Demolition/Clearance

Demolition and clearance are essential processes in urban planning and development. They involve the safe and efficient removal of buildings and structures that are no longer fit for use. In Huddersfield, these services help in revitalising areas, making space for new constructions, and ensuring public safety. Without proper demolition and clearance, old and unsafe structures could pose significant risks to residents and visitors alike.

Safety First: Ensuring Safe Demolition Practices

Safety is paramount in demolition and clearance operations. In Huddersfield, companies must adhere to strict safety regulations to protect workers and the public. This includes using appropriate equipment, following safety protocols, and ensuring that all personnel are adequately trained. By prioritising safety, demolition companies can prevent accidents and ensure that the process is completed without incident.

Environmental Considerations in Demolition

Environmental impact is a significant concern in demolition projects. In Huddersfield, companies are increasingly adopting eco-friendly practices to minimise waste and pollution. This includes recycling materials, using sustainable methods, and ensuring that hazardous substances are disposed of safely. By focusing on environmental considerations, demolition companies can contribute to a more sustainable future for Huddersfield.

Types of Demolition Services in Huddersfield

Huddersfield offers a range of demolition services to meet the diverse needs of its residents and businesses. These services include:

  • Residential Demolition: This involves the removal of houses and small residential buildings. It's often required for redevelopment projects or when a building is deemed unsafe.
  • Commercial Demolition: This service is for larger structures such as office buildings, shopping centres, and industrial facilities. It requires specialised equipment and expertise.
  • Selective Demolition: This involves the removal of specific parts of a building while preserving the rest. It's often used in renovation projects.
  • Interior Demolition: This focuses on the removal of interior components, such as walls, ceilings, and fixtures, without affecting the building's structure.

The Role of Clearance Services

Clearance services are an integral part of the demolition process. They involve the removal of debris, waste, and other materials left behind after a building is demolished. In Huddersfield, clearance services help in maintaining cleanliness and safety on construction sites, ensuring that the area is ready for new developments.

Efficient Waste Management

Effective waste management is crucial in clearance operations. Companies in Huddersfield must ensure that waste is disposed of responsibly, following local regulations and environmental guidelines. This includes sorting materials for recycling, safely disposing of hazardous waste, and minimising landfill use. By managing waste efficiently, clearance services contribute to a cleaner and more sustainable environment.

Recycling and Reuse of Materials

Recycling and reusing materials are key components of modern clearance services. In Huddersfield, many companies focus on salvaging materials such as bricks, metals, and wood for reuse in new projects. This not only reduces waste but also conserves resources and reduces the environmental impact of demolition activities.

Regulations and Compliance in Huddersfield

Demolition and clearance activities in Huddersfield are subject to strict regulations to ensure safety and environmental protection. Companies must comply with local laws and obtain the necessary permits before commencing any project. This includes conducting risk assessments, notifying relevant authorities, and adhering to health and safety standards.

Obtaining Necessary Permits

Before any demolition project can begin, companies in Huddersfield must obtain the appropriate permits from local authorities. This process involves submitting detailed plans and ensuring that all safety and environmental considerations are addressed. By obtaining the necessary permits, companies can avoid legal issues and ensure that their projects proceed smoothly.

Adhering to Health and Safety Standards

Health and safety are critical in demolition and clearance operations. Companies in Huddersfield must follow strict standards to protect workers and the public. This includes providing proper training, using safety equipment, and implementing measures to prevent accidents. By adhering to these standards, companies can ensure a safe working environment and successful project outcomes.

Challenges in Demolition/Clearance Projects

Demolition and clearance projects in Huddersfield can present various challenges. These may include dealing with hazardous materials, managing noise and dust, and ensuring minimal disruption to the surrounding community. By anticipating these challenges and implementing effective strategies, companies can overcome obstacles and complete projects successfully.

Managing Hazardous Materials

Hazardous materials, such as asbestos and lead, can pose significant risks during demolition projects. In Huddersfield, companies must take special precautions to handle and dispose of these materials safely. This includes conducting thorough inspections, using protective equipment, and following strict disposal guidelines.

Minimising Noise and Dust

Noise and dust are common by-products of demolition activities. In Huddersfield, companies must implement measures to minimise their impact on the surrounding community. This includes using noise-reducing equipment, implementing dust control measures, and scheduling work during less disruptive times.

Future Trends in Demolition/Clearance

The demolition and clearance industry in Huddersfield is constantly evolving, with new technologies and practices emerging to improve efficiency and sustainability. Some future trends include the use of advanced machinery, increased focus on recycling, and the adoption of digital tools for project management.

Advanced Machinery and Technology

Technological advancements are transforming the demolition industry. In Huddersfield, companies are increasingly using advanced machinery, such as robotic demolition equipment and drones, to enhance precision and safety. These technologies allow for more efficient operations and reduce the risk of accidents.

Digital Tools for Project Management

Digital tools are becoming an essential part of demolition and clearance projects. In Huddersfield, companies are using software for project planning, monitoring, and communication. These tools help streamline operations, improve collaboration, and ensure that projects are completed on time and within budget.
